The job market for Real Estate jobs in Pakistan is diverse and dynamic, with many reputable companies seeking skilled professionals. The real estate sector not only includes residential and commercial property listings but also expands into areas like real estate investment trusts (REITs), property development, and real estate consultancy. Major cities, such as Karachi, Lahore, and Islamabad, have seen a surge in real estate activities, providing plenty of opportunities. According to recent statistics, the real estate sector contributes approximately 2% to Pakistan's GDP and continues to grow at a robust pace, making it a promising field for job seekers.
Working in the real estate industry in Pakistan offers various advantages, including competitive salaries that range from PKR 30,000 to PKR 200,000 a month, depending on the role and experience. Notable companies such as Zameen.com, Graana.com, and JLL Pakistan are prominent employers in this sector, offering professionals a chance to work on exciting projects. Additionally, the work culture in Pakistan emphasizes relationships and trust, which are crucial in real estate. With a population exceeding 240 million, the need for housing and commercial spaces is ever-increasing, providing many job openings for job seekers looking to enter or advance in this field.
